Toyota Tacoma Skid Plate - Transmission Transfer Case - Rival 4x4 - Aluminum - `16-`23 is a Rival aluminum skid plate designed to protect the transmission and transfer case on 2016–2023 (3rd gen) Toyota Tacoma 4WD models. It provides a low-weight protective barrier for off-road use and daily driving without adding unnecessary mass.
Constructed from corrosion-resistant aluminum, this skid plate shields vulnerable driveline components from rocks, trail debris, and road hazards. Specifically shaped for the 3rd-generation Tacoma (2016–2023) 4WD, the plate clears factory components while positioning under the vehicle to guard both the transmission and transfer case. The design maintains service access for routine maintenance and mounts to factory attachment points for a reliable fit. For enthusiasts who spend time on trails, this part helps reduce the risk of costly damage while keeping ground clearance and vehicle balance in mind.
